AfStdWflHeadLstGet: Unterschied zwischen den Versionen
Zur Navigation springen
Zur Suche springen
Jens (Diskussion | Beiträge) K Jens verschob die Seite AFStdWflHeadLstGet nach AfStdWflHeadLstGet, ohne dabei eine Weiterleitung anzulegen |
Jens (Diskussion | Beiträge) K Stand 4.1.09 |
||
Zeile 6: | Zeile 6: | ||
</tr> | </tr> | ||
<tr class="ProcSyntax"> | <tr class="ProcSyntax"> | ||
<td class="title"> | <td class="title"> AfStdWflHeadLstGet(int1) : int</td> | ||
<td class="platforms"> | <td class="platforms"> | ||
[[file:DE_SymbolAPI.gif|alt=Ausführbar von der API|link=Befehle der Schnittstellen]][[file:DE_SymbolNoDLL.gif|alt=Nicht ausführbar von der Programmierschnittstelle (DLL)|link=Befehle der Schnittstellen]][[file:DE_SymbolNoARC.gif|alt=Nicht ausführbar mit der Application Remote Control|link=Befehle der Schnittstellen]][[file:DE_SymbolScriptAPI.gif|alt=Ausführbar von der Script-API|link=Befehle der Schnittstellen]] | [[file:DE_SymbolAPI.gif|alt=Ausführbar von der API|link=Befehle der Schnittstellen]][[file:DE_SymbolNoDLL.gif|alt=Nicht ausführbar von der Programmierschnittstelle (DLL)|link=Befehle der Schnittstellen]][[file:DE_SymbolNoARC.gif|alt=Nicht ausführbar mit der Application Remote Control|link=Befehle der Schnittstellen]][[file:DE_SymbolScriptAPI.gif|alt=Ausführbar von der Script-API|link=Befehle der Schnittstellen]] | ||
Zeile 34: | Zeile 34: | ||
<td width="85%" class=Right colspan="3"> | <td width="85%" class=Right colspan="3"> | ||
[[:Category:Befehle für Workflows|Verwandte Befehle]], | [[:Category:Befehle für Workflows|Verwandte Befehle]], | ||
[[ | [[AfStdWflHeadRead#|AfStdWflHeadRead()]], | ||
[[ | [[AfStdWflDetRead#|AfStdWflDetRead()]] | ||
</td> | </td> | ||
</tr> | </tr> | ||
Zeile 45: | Zeile 45: | ||
</table> | </table> | ||
<div class="BigLang"> | <div class="BigLang"> | ||
<p><p>Die Funktion ermittelt alle definierten Standardworkflows. Der Anweisung wird eine leere CTE-Liste übergeben, die zuvor mit [[ | <p><p>Die Funktion ermittelt alle definierten Standardworkflows. Der Anweisung wird eine leere CTE-Liste übergeben, die zuvor mit [[AfCteOpen#|AfCteOpen()]] angelegt werden muss.</p> | ||
<p>Nach dem Aufruf der Funktion befindet sich für jeden Standardworkflow ein Element in der Liste. Die ID des Standardworkflows kann über die Eigenschaft <font class=source>Name</font> ermittelt werden.</p> | <p>Nach dem Aufruf der Funktion befindet sich für jeden Standardworkflow ein Element in der Liste. Die ID des Standardworkflows kann über die Eigenschaft <font class=source>Name</font> ermittelt werden.</p> | ||
Zeile 56: | Zeile 56: | ||
<pre class=source> | <pre class=source> | ||
tCteList # AfCteOpen(_CteList); | tCteList # AfCteOpen(_CteList); | ||
tErr # | tErr # AfStdWflHeadLstGet(tCteList); | ||
for tCteItem # tCteList->CteRead(_CteFirst); | for tCteItem # tCteList->CteRead(_CteFirst); | ||
Zeile 65: | Zeile 65: | ||
... | ... | ||
} | } | ||
tCteList-> | tCteList->AfCteCloseAll(); | ||
</pre></p> | </pre></p> | ||
Aktuelle Version vom 4. November 2024, 13:24 Uhr
![]() |
|||||||||||||
AfStdWflHeadLstGet(int1) : int | |||||||||||||
Liste der Standardworkflows ermitteln | |||||||||||||
|
Die Funktion ermittelt alle definierten Standardworkflows. Der Anweisung wird eine leere CTE-Liste übergeben, die zuvor mit AfCteOpen() angelegt werden muss.
Nach dem Aufruf der Funktion befindet sich für jeden Standardworkflow ein Element in der Liste. Die ID des Standardworkflows kann über die Eigenschaft Name ermittelt werden.
Beispiel:
Ermitteln aller Standardworkflows.
tCteList # AfCteOpen(_CteList); tErr # AfStdWflHeadLstGet(tCteList); for tCteItem # tCteList->CteRead(_CteFirst); loop tCteItem # tCteList->CteRead(_CteNext, tCteItem); while (tCteItem > 0) { tStdWflId # CnvIA(tCteItem->spName); ... } tCteList->AfCteCloseAll();
Neben den allgemeinen Fehlerwerten können folgende Werte zurückgegeben werden:
Konstante | Wert | Bedeutung |
_ErrOk | 0 | ok - kein Fehler aufgetreten |
_rNoRec | 5 | Es sind keine Standardworkflows definiert. |
Für weitere CONZEPT 16-spezifische Rückgabewerte siehe die aktuelle CONZEPT 16-Hilfe.